The SPX 500 sits about 5 points lower (as of 9:00am) than yesterday’s close on the S&P 500 after the release of the lower than expected US GDP report (2.8% actual vs 3.0% estimates).

Greek PSI debates will get Draghi’d into the weekend as always. Anything related to Europe never seems to be resolved quickly. The Euro is hovering just above 1.31.

The beginning of the month usually plays out to be the high or low and set the trend. We will have to see if today’s sentiment will play into next week putting an end to the early 2012 rally. We don’t want to throw all our chips on one hand and call a top, wait for confirmation.
